"Bad Guy" – Ben, Jackson and Emmett are put in a precarious and dangerous position with a potential victim. Andy's search for more background on her family opens her eyes, and Vic and Travis are caught in the middle of a corruption scheme, on an all-new episode of "Station 19," airing THURSDAY, MAY 7 (9:00-10:01 p.m. EDT), on ABC. (TV-14, DLSV) Episodes can also be viewed the next day on demand and on Hulu.

“Station 19” stars Jaina Lee Ortiz as Andy Herrera, Jason George as Ben Warren, Boris Kodjoe as Captain Robert Sullivan, Grey Damon as Jack Gibson, Barrett Doss as Victoria Hughes, Jay Hayden as Travis Montgomery, Okieriete Onaodowan as Dean Miller, Danielle Savre as Maya Bishop and Miguel Sandoval as Captain Pruitt Herrera.

Guest starring in "Bad Guy" are Chandra Wilson as Miranda Bailey, Jesse Williams as Jackson Avery, Jake Borelli as Levi Schmidt, Pat Healy as Chief Dixon, Lachlan Buchanan as Emmett Dixon, Stefania Spampinato as Carina DeLuca, Drew Rausch as John Finch, Jennifer Kim as Darcie, Peter Paige as Cooper, Rebekah Kennedy as Melly Wyatt, Mark Collier as Gary, Matthew Downs as Officer Reaser, Brenda Arteaga-Walsh as Officer Marinis and Peter Onorati as Snuffy.

Vic in this episode

Vic is shown in a flashback from 2012 rehearsing when she starts crying. She tells her teacher that her grandmother had died and that she is sorry for crying. He tells her that she can be sad and dance and sing at the same time, so she goes back to rehearsing. Back in present time, Vic and Travis talk about their shift when Vic sees Jackson and gets all nervous and acts weird around him. When everyone but Travis leaves, Vic notices the tension between Travis and Emmett and then admit to having done something bad with Jackson. As they are on their way out, Sullivan stops them and gives them extra work. Vic and Travis conduct fire inspections but the guy tells them that everything is taken care of and they can leave. There is another flashback that shows Vic rehearsing when Pruitt walks in to do a fire inspection himself. In present time, Vic calls Sullivan to assist in the matter and he tells her and Travis that he got things wrong and everything is approved and they can go home. Later at the bar, Vic and Travis are talking about Chief Dixon and Sullivan being corrupt and Vic decides to confront Sullivan about it but he shuts her down. We see another flashback of Vic singing when the theater catches fire and her teacher Cooper dies tragically. Vic is saved by Pruitt and that's how she became a firefighter which she ends up telling Dean. They talk about the whole Sullivan and Dixon mess when Jack joins them and tells Vic that Jackson got shot. She looks worried and excuses herself.
